Two workers killed as temporary lift crashes in Karaikal

Special Correspondent

KARAIKAL: Two workers were killed and two others sustained serious injuries, when the steel wire carrying a temporary lift in which they were taking materials for the construction of an overhead water tank suddenly snapped and crashed on to the ground at T.R. Pattinam near Karaikal on Saturday.

Police sources said that the accident occurred when four construction workers — Natarajan (40) of Vallundampattu, Siva (38) of Vilar Road, Thanjavur, Sundararajan (35) of Soorakottai, Thanjavur and Dhanabal (25) of Gandharvakottai in Pudukottai district — were going up in the lift to the top of the tank. The lift wire attached to a crane suddenly snapped, and the lift crashed from a height of about 50 ft.

Natarajan and Siva died on way to hospital. Sundarajan and Dhanabal were admitted to the Government hospital in Karaikal

The Public Works Department is engaged in the construction of 10 lakh litre capacity water tank at a cost of Rs.1 crore in T.R. Patttinam.
